First published in 1933 in three sections, as the second edition of a 1927 original, this book was created to provide children from seven to eleven years of age with an introduction to a broad range of poetry. At the time of publication, the selection was notable for containing a high proportion of works by contemporary writers, together with numerous old favourites. The selections are carefully arranged so that there is a clear sense of continuity. This book will remain of value to younger readers and anyone with an interest in poetry anthologies.
